The product family PMG/PCMG with DC input voltage completes the range of primary switched MTM Power Modules. The modules offer an input range of 20...72 VDC and allow - due to the different types available in this series - efficient solutions in numerous application fields. They are available with single, dual or triple outputs. The single and dual (sym.) versions are UL 60 950 and UL 508 approved. Dimensions are 90,5 x 65,5 x 33,5 mm for PCB-mounting (PMG) and 120,0 x 65,5 x 33,0 mm for chassis mounting (PCMG). Thus, they offer the same dimensions and pinning as the standard AC/DC and low voltage modules of the same wattage range which allows the customer to design only one layout for standard AC, low voltage and DC input. The vacuum encapsulated devices offer an isolation of 3,3 kVrms and comply to the up-to-date EN standards as regards CE conformity. Further features are rugged design, SMD-technology, automatic 100 % final test and 100-%-burn-in-test. The series PMG/PCMG offers 15 W or 30 W constant output wattage, is short circuit protected and needs no ground load.

SMD-Package 1 to 15W
Our range of isolated DC/DC converters in SMD package offers products from 1 to 15W with unregulated or regulated output voltages. All models provide high pin accuracy and are qualified for automated ick-and-place machines.
They can withstand the high temperatures in lead-free reflow solder processes and comply with IPC J-STD-020C standard. All products can also be supplied in tape and reel package.
High Performance 3 to 60W
Our TEN series is an extensive range of high performance DC/DC converters with output power ranges from 3 to 60W, offering excellent specifications and very high power density in shielded metal packages. Models with wide 2:1 or ultra-wide 4:1 input ranges are available. All TEN series models offer an extended operating temperature range of -40 to 85°C and provide an internal EMI-filter.

Compact DC/DC converters for DIN rail and wall mounting
At 100 Watt and 500 Watt the latest DC/DC converters from Zentro Elektrik extend the existing comprehensive range of converters.
The compact DC/DC converters are designed for applications in automation engineering, power supply and power station engineering, in traffic systems and railway in particular, and in mechanical engineering. They are air-cooled and have many control, operating and display elements.
Connections are made by means of easy-to-use screw terminals.
The converters are distinguished by a high degree of efficiency of > 80% and comprehensive protective and control facilities such as protection from overload and overvoltage, thermal protection and decoupling diodes. Options such as a varistor at the output, to prove additional overvoltage protection or a signal relay, further distinguish the
GWH 100 / 500 series of converters. Up to 3 units with active current sharing can be switched in parallel to extend power.

XP Power announces its JCA series of miniature, board-mounted low power DC/DC converters. Measuring just 1 x 0.8 x 0.4 inches (25.4 x 20.3 x 10.0 mm), the device's shielded metal package is 0.25 inches (6.4 mm) shorter than the 1.25 inch (31.8 mm) industry norm. Using the customary 24-pin DIP layout, the units occupy 20% less printed circuit board area than traditional products. This allows designers to reduce the size of new developments or add in more features, while maintaining the industry standard pin-out makes the converter an ideal drop-in replacement for existing designs.

The charge pump ICs provide inverted voltage (XC6351) or double step-up voltage(XC9801) with only 2 external capacitors connected. IC shrinkage is realized compared to DC/DC controllers that use choke coils. The XC6351Series are integrated in to SOT-26 packages. The output is inverted and negative voltage. The XC9801 are double step-up ICs and integrated in to MSOP-8A packages.

The AIC1845 is a micropower charge pump DC/DC converter that produces a regulated 5V output. The input voltage range is 2.7V to 5.0V. Extremely low operating current (13uA typical with no load) and a low external-part count (one 0.22uF flying capacitor and two small bypass capacitors at VIN and VOUT ) make the AIC1845 ideally suitable for small, battery-powered ap-plications.
The AIC1845 operates as a PSM (Pulse Skip-ping Modulation) mode switched capacitor volt-age doubler to produce a regulated output and features with thermal shutdown capability and short circuit protection.
The AIC1845 is available in a 6-pin SOT-23 package.

The AIC1579 is a high-power, high-efficiency voltage-mode DC/DC controller for motherboard VI/O power supply applications. Designed to drive an N-channel MOSFET in a standard buck topology, the AIC1579 features a high voltage CMOS output driver, short-circuit protection, and 8-pin package.
An external 4-bit Digital-to-Analog Converter (DAC) can be used along with the AIC1579 to adjust the output voltage from 2.0V to 3.5V in 0.1V increments. Table 1 on the following page specifies the corresponding output voltage for 16 combinations of DAC inputs as in the typical application circuit.
The 200KHz switching frequency allows for using small external components while maintaining high conversion efficiency. The 11MHz bandwidth and 6V/uS slew rate of the error amplifier ensures high converter bandwidth and fast transient response.
The AIC1579 provides adjustable overcurrent and short-circuit protections by sensing the output current across the on resistance of the external N-channel MOSFET rather than an external low value sense resistor.
The AIC1579L provides lower reference voltage (1.30V) than the default (2.00V, AIC1579) for lower VOUT requirement.

The AIC1638 is a high efficiency step-up DC/DC converter for applications using 1 to 4 NiMH battery cells. Only three external components are required to deliver a fixed output voltage of 2.7V, 3.0V, 3.3V, 4.5V or 5V. The AIC1638 starts up from less than 0.9V input with 1mA load. Pulse Frequency Modulation scheme brings optimized performance for applications with light output loading and low input voltages. The output ripple and noise are lower compared with the circuits operating in PSM mode.
The PFM control circuit operating in 100KHz (max.) switching rate results in smaller passive components. The space saving SOT-23, SOT-89 and TO-92 packages make the AIC1638 an ideal choice of DC/DC converter for space conscious applications, like pagers, electronic cameras, and wireless microphones.
